Think the Brits are stuffy? You don’t know the half of it. See a bunch of disgruntled British housewives protest against a man accused of “polygameat” — the practice of eating more than one meat in a burger.

By Crispin Porter + Bogusky for Burger King’s Meat Beast Whopper. Sorta reminds me of that meatatarian thing Wendy’s is promoting.
